1. Obtain and record vital signs, assessments, chief complaints, medical history, height/weight, etc. as appropriate 2. Perform basic clinical procedures such as wound dressing, specimen collection, point of care testing, EKGs, etc. (as trained) 3. Administer and record all medications and treatments based on provider orders accurately using proper procedures 4. Record all care information concisely, accurately, and completely in a timely manner 5. Assist providers with exams, minor procedures, and urgent care needs 6. Prepare, stock, and sterilize exam rooms and clinical equipment 7. Communicate test instructions and follow-up plans to patients clearly and effectively 8. Assist with patient outreach for lab results, chronic disease follow-up, and preventative-care reminders 9. Collaborate with the care team to ensure timely documentation and quality care delivery 10. Accurately document all patient interactions, procedures, medications, and communications in the Electronic Health Record 11. Follow RHC regulations, safety protocols, and infection control standards 12. Monitor and maintain clinic supplies and equipment usage. Notifies appropriate departments to replenish stock, as necessary. 13. Participate in Performance Improvement on a monthly basis. 14. Maintain knowledge regarding use of defibrillators, holter monitors, etc. 15. Perform and documents quality controls daily 16. Uphold HIPAA and patient privacy standards 17. Provide basic health education, medication instructions, and lifestyle guidelines within skill level and training 18. Maintains a neat and orderly work area. 19. Assists with diabetic foot care, as needed 20. Performs other duties as assigned.
Graduate of a course for LPN. Must be licensed in the state of Louisiana. CPR certified.
No experience necessary.
